Fasi di Implementazione
Month 1–2
Phase 1: Administrative Decongestant
- ☐Deploy AI-driven scheduling via tools like Reclaim.ai or Motion to manage trainer availability across multiple Amsterdam locations.
- ☐Automate student enrollment and FAQ responses using Chatbase, trained specifically on your course catalogs and Dutch VAT requirements.
- ☐Use Whisper (OpenAI) to transcribe all live sessions for instant student notes and searchable archives.
- ☐Implement Zapier loops to connect your CRM (like HubSpot) to course delivery platforms, eliminating manual data entry.
Month 3–5
Phase 2: Multilingual Content Engine
- ☐Use Synthesia or HeyGen to create multilingual video modules, allowing one trainer to 'present' in Dutch, English, and German without re-filming.
- ☐Integrate Claude 3.5 Sonnet to draft localized curriculum and case studies specific to the Dutch market (e.g., using AEX-listed companies as examples).
- ☐Automate the creation of assessment quizzes and feedback loops using Typeform’s AI features or specialized tools like Quizgecko.
- ☐Set up AI-assisted marketing workflows to target corporate HR departments in the Amstel Business Park.
Month 6+
Phase 3: Hyper-Personalized Learning
- ☐Launch an 'AI Tutor' for every course—a custom-tuned LLM that helps students with homework 24/7 without human intervention.
- ☐Implement predictive analytics to identify 'at-risk' students who are disengaging, triggered by activity data in your LMS.
- ☐Develop AI-generated skill gap analyses for corporate clients, showing them exactly where their workforce needs the most training.
- ☐Explore VR/AR training integrations for vocational courses, using AI to generate 3D scenarios on the fly.

Compliance
Navigating the EU AI Act in the Amsterdam EdTech Ecosystem
- •Educational institutions in Amsterdam must prioritize compliance with the EU AI Act, which categorizes AI used in education and vocational training as 'High-Risk'.
- •Implementation requires rigorous data governance and human-in-the-loop (HITL) oversight for systems used for student admissions, grading, and proctoring.
- •Penny recommends establishing a localized 'AI Ethics Board' that aligns with the City of Amsterdam’s 'Digital City' agenda, ensuring algorithmic transparency for the diverse, international student body.
- •Technical documentation must be maintained in both Dutch and English to satisfy local regulators (AP - Autoriteit Persoonsgegevens) and international stakeholders.
Methodology
Hyper-Personalized Multilingual Learning Paths
To address Amsterdam's unique demographic—a mix of native Dutch speakers, expats, and international students—we deploy Large Language Models (LLMs) specifically tuned for 'Code-Switching.' Our methodology involves: 1. **Semantic Mapping:** Aligning curriculum objectives across Dutch (NVAO standards) and international frameworks. 2. **Real-time Translation Layers:** Using RAG (Retrieval-Augmented Generation) to provide instant contextual support in 40+ languages without losing the pedagogical nuance of the original material. 3. **Adaptive Feedback Loops:** AI agents that analyze student sentiment and cognitive load in real-time, adjusting the complexity of Dutch-language immersion for non-native learners.
Integration
Bridging the 'Amsterdam Skills Gap' via Predictive Analytics
- •Leveraging local labor market data from the Amsterdam Economic Board to feed predictive AI models that dynamically update vocational training curricula.
- •Automated gap analysis: Comparing current student competencies against real-time job postings in the Noord-Holland region (specifically tech and green energy sectors).
- •Deployment of 'Digital Twins' for corporate training environments, allowing Amsterdam-based firms to simulate organizational restructuring and identify necessary 'upskilling' paths before implementation.
- •Integration with SURF (the collaborative ICT organization for Dutch education) to ensure secure, federated identity management across decentralized AI learning modules.
